Herb Rodgers Passes



Legendary Canadian drag racer Herbie 'Go-Fast' Rodgers passed away recently after complications from a long and courageous battle with cancer. Rodgers campaigned the 'Flying Glass' Alcohol Funny Car for many years with a great deal of success, the most notable being the big win at the IHRA Empire Nationals in New York in 1993.

Rodgers was also invited by NHRA to attend the Suzuka circuit in Japan in the mid-1990's as a Canadian competitor. Rodgers's last runs were at the Featherlite Can-Am Nationals at St. Thomas Dragway last June 29 & 30 where he recorded two six second passes at over 200mph.
